Heat index

The heat index value during November is estimated at a very hot 35°C (95°F). Implement additional cautionary measures, heat cramps and heat exhaustion could occur. Prolonged activity might induce heatstroke.
Records show heat index calculations are tailored for shaded regions and mild winds. Uninterrupted exposure to the sun may boost the he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', is a composite of temperature and humidity figures to convey how warm it feels. This effect is subjective, differing among individuals based on their physical activity and perception of heat, which can be influenced by factors like wind, clothing, and metabolic variances. Given direct exposure to sunlight, one might experience a rise in the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ely vital to babies and toddlers. Youths are typically more endangered than adults since they usually sweat less. Their larger skin surface concerning their smaller bodies and higher heat production due to activity further adds to their vulnerability.
The human body has a built-in cooling mechanism through perspiration; evaporating sweat dissipates the excess heat. In the presence of high relative humidity, the evaporation rate diminishes, resulting in the body retaining more warmth compared to dry conditions. With body temperatures on the rise, inefficient heat shedding can lead to dehydration and its associated complications.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in November is 78%.

Rainfall

In Guaico, Trinidad and Tobago, in November, it is raining for 18.6 days, with typically 81mm (3.19") of accumulated precipitation. In Guaico, Trinidad and Tobago, during the entire year, the rain falls for 194.8 days and collects up to 640mm (25.2") of precipitation.

Daylight

In November, the average length of the day in Guaico is 11h and 38min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:55 and sunset at 17:40. On the last day of November, in Guaico, sunrise is at 06:06 and sunset at 17:40 AST.

Sunshine

In November, the average sunshine in Guaico is 7.3h.
